Workers
and their spouses consider various aspects of their
retirement years in this 10-session program held at
Local Union halls. Each session is devoted to a different
topic with experts providing information and guidance
on the issues listed below.

You don't
have to wait until you're nearing retirement to benefit from
this program. In fact, the sooner you start to plan for your
life of leisure, the easier the transition will be.
